AMD EPYC Embedded 9124 vs Opteron A1120

We compared two server CPUs: AMD EPYC Embedded 9124 with 16 cores 3GHz and Opteron A1120 with 4 cores 1.7G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D EPYC Embedded 9124's Advantages
Released 7 years and 2 months late
Higher specification of memory (DDR5-4800 vs DDR3)
Newer PCIe version (5 vs 3)
Higher base frequency (3GHz vs 1.7GHz)
Larger L3 cache size (64MB vs 8MB)
More modern manufacturing process (5nm vs 28nm)
Opteron A1120's Advantages
Lower TDP (25W vs 200W)
